Russian Foreign Ministry on Syria, Ukraine, and NATO

by Stephen Lendman

According to Russian Foreign Ministry spokeswoman Maria Zakharova (MZ below), liberating Daraa and Quneitra in southwest Syria from US-supported terrorists “is in its final stage.”

AMN News concurred, saying anti-government forces “are on the verge of losing their remaining territory in southwest Syria after a string of losses to the Syrian Arab Army (SAA),” notably in Daraa.

The offensive to liberate Quneitra remains to be launched, the last major battle to liberate southwest Syria from US-supported terrorists.

Pentagon and allied forces illegally occupying southwest and northeast Syria remain to be dealt with. Whether resolution of this issue comes out of Putin/Trump summit talks remains to be seen.

It’s likely a long shot at best, regardless of what’s said publicly in a joint press conference and/or a concluding statement if one is issued.

MZ: “(T)he province of Daraa has been liberated almost completely.” Syrian forces regained control of the border with Jordan, the Beirut-Damascus-Amman highway again open to traffic.

MZ highlighted “vast amounts of modern (US and other) Western-made weapons and equipment transferred by pacified militants to the Syrian army, including various ATGM systems, armored vehicles, small arms and ammunition representing material evidence of gross external interference in Syrian affairs.”

Refugees displaced by fighting were many fewer in numbers than anti-Syrian propaganda reports. They’re now free to return home to liberated areas.

MZ: “The Syrian government is providing” humanitarian aid. So is Russia, not the UN and rest of the world community, supplying it to terror-controlled areas alone, for their use, not civilians held hostage.

MZ slammed neocon US representative to Ukraine’s putschist regime Kurt Volker’s hostile remarks about Russia and Donbass freedom fighters refusing to live under fascist rule, saying he ignores “evidence of the constant ceasefire violations by Ukraine’s Armed Forces in the country’s east.”

“(S)ince January 2018, the number of incidents involving artillery fire by the Ukrainian Armed forces against residential communities surged five-fold” - weapons and munitions supplied by Washington supporting Kiev aggression against its own people.

Ukrainian media “continue to rapidly deteriorate,” independent journalists targeted for elimination by imprisonment or assassination.

Russian RIA Novosti journalist Kirill Vyshinsky was arrested, falsely accused of “high treason” for doing his job responsibly.

Kiev so far turned a deaf ear to Moscow’s demand for his release, adding the international community ignores “the deteriorating situation” of free expression by the regime.

“(F)oreign journalists continue to be prevented from entering the country.” US-installed Kiev putschists suppress dissent and restrict free expression when diverging from the official narrative.

MZ slammed US-dominated NATO for “accusing Russia of fueling tensions in the Euro-Atlantic area. The (alliance) is building up its own military activity under this pretext even in the once quiet regions of the Baltics and Northern Europe.”

“…NATO positions itself as a defensive alliance, while increasing purchases of offensive weapons.” 

Instead of preventing “unintentional incidents,” US-led alliance members conduct hostile “maneuvers close to the Russian borders.”

“Its calls for dialogue within the Russia-NATO Council are followed by an expulsion of our diplomats and refusal to conduct dialogue between the militaries.”

Combined military spending of its 29 member states is many times greater than Russia’s.

Thousands of US-led NATO forces are provocatively positioned along Russia’s borders. Longstanding US policy calls for containing and isolating the Russian Federation despite no threat to its security or to other alliance members.
